torsdag 15. desember 2016

Sql if 0 then

Bufret Oversett denne siden Example. Test whether two strings are the same and return YES if they are, or NO if not: SELECT IF (STRCMP(hello,bye) = , YES, NO);. Value to return if boolean_expression evaluates to false.


But do you know the other way to prevent division by zero in SQL ? MySQL IF () takes three expressions and if the first expression is true, not zero and. The following SQL statement will display the number of books . Be careful with CASE WHEN when dealing with numeric columns and using zero literal. What I want is something that works like the SQL function ISNULL(), where you can pass in a value just. If is not Zero, then I pass back the original value.


This section describes the SQL -compliant conditional expressions available in PostgreSQL. TeamSQL cross-platform SQL client blog provides tips, tricks, and advice for. Then , when we have a math, date, string or boolean expression involving a. COALESCE(other_charges, ) AS total to pay FROM services;. Syntax, NULLIFZERO(expression).


Alternatives, NULLIF(expression, ), NULLIF and CASE are ANSI SQL compliant. An SQL expression (such as a literal value or field name.). Single-level if - then -else expression.


The Where clause says equals case when the price is less than a 10 output one, else end. The IF THEN ELSIF statement runs the first statements for which condition is true. Conditional Count Of Columns Sql. Your understanding is correct.


SQL CASE statement described in Section 13. Not to be outdone, T- SQL contains a CASE statement as well. This article will bring you SQL tricks that many of you might not have. I recently needed to use an IF statment in a WHERE clause with MySQL.


In the above example, if the value from the column myfield matches somevalue then the. IF function returns or 0. Learn how to use the SQL UPDATE Statement in your database, how to. This means if you have already used COMMIT times, ROLLBACK will have an. D- -1-and a department name “Quality Control”, and then run it, . If first select a is not null then retrieve only the result from select a. You could use the DECODE function in a SQL statement as follows: SELECT supplier_name.


In the example above, if any of the UnitsOnOrder values are NULL, the result is. Part of a series of Fun with SQL blog posts on the Citus Data blog, this. SQL tests WHEN conditions in the order they appear in the . IF MOD(v_num,2) = THEN DBMS_OUTPUT. If condition is not met, then sum of all values of y. NULL and expr is not , the IF.


If the expr evaluates to TRUE i. Generates an error if the result overflows. Avoiding division by zero with NULLIF, Five SQL Tips in Five Days, Part 5. NULLIF compares two expressions and returns null if they are equal or the. SUM(CASE r.passed WHEN TRUE THEN ELSE END) AS . SQL WHERE clause is essential, if you want to select the right bit of your. One of the key features of SQL databases is their support for ad-hoc queries: new.


This practice does more harm than good if the database uses a shared . ELSE paid END CASE WHEN Time on Page = THEN ELSE END . CASE WHEN condition THEN result WHEN condition THEN result WHEN condition. The limitations are the same as for the Java data type java.

Ingen kommentarer:

Legg inn en kommentar

Merk: Bare medlemmer av denne bloggen kan legge inn en kommentar.

Populære innlegg